Milky Quartz with Iron Staining
Silicon Dioxide (SiO2)
Hardness: 7 on Mohs scale; Color: White to translucent with orange/brown iron oxide staining; Luster: Vitreous to greasy; Crystal Structure: Trigonal/Hexagonal; Cleavage: None (conchoidal fracture); Specific Gravity: 2.65

Formation & geological history
Formed in hydrothermal veins or pegmatites where silica-rich fluids cool and crystallize. The orange staining is caused by secondary oxidation of iron-bearing minerals like goethite or hematite infiltrating fractures.
Uses & applications
Industrial use in glassmaking, electronics, and abrasives. As a specimen, it is popular for metaphysical use and beginner rock collecting.
Geological facts
Quartz is the second most abundant mineral in Earth's continental crust. Specimens like this are often called 'Golden Healer' in spiritual circles due to the iron-rich inclusions.
Field identification & locations
Identified by its ability to scratch glass, lack of cleavage, and translucent 'milky' appearance. It is found globally, especially in mountain ranges and riverbeds.
